A Post Doc Research Fellow, often abbreviated as postdoc, refers to a temporary academic position for recent PhD graduates. This role bridges the gap between doctoral training and independent research careers. Post Doc Research Fellows meaning involves conducting advanced, specialized research under the guidance of a principal investigator (PI), typically lasting one to three years. The position emphasizes producing high-impact publications, securing further funding, and developing teaching or leadership skills.
In essence, it is a postdoctoral fellowship focused on research excellence, allowing scholars to deepen expertise in their field while building a robust professional network. Unlike permanent faculty roles, Post Doc Research Fellow jobs are project-specific and grant-funded, offering flexibility but requiring proactive career planning.
Postdoctoral fellowships originated in the early 20th century in the United States, inspired by European research apprenticeships. By the 1950s, they became standard for life sciences and expanded globally. In Sri Lanka, such positions gained traction post-1980s with the establishment of the National Research Council (NRC) in 1986, promoting research capacity amid economic liberalization. Today, they align with national goals like the National Science Policy, fostering innovation in areas such as biotechnology and climate studies.
Post Doc Research Fellows lead experiments, analyze data, and co-author papers in peer-reviewed journals. They often mentor graduate students, apply for grants, and present findings at international conferences. Daily tasks include designing methodologies, managing lab resources, and collaborating interdisciplinary. In Sri Lanka, roles may involve fieldwork, such as marine biology surveys or agricultural trials, contributing to local challenges like sustainable development.
Sri Lanka's higher education landscape features universities like the University of Colombo, Peradeniya, and Moratuwa offering Post Doc Research Fellow positions. Funded by UGC (University Grants Commission), NRC, or projects like World Bank AHEAD, these roles support national priorities in STEM and social sciences. For instance, Peradeniya's postgraduate institute hosts fellows in Ayurveda research. Opportunities are growing with international partnerships, though fewer than in Western countries—around 100-200 annually across institutions. Required academic qualifications: A PhD (Doctor of Philosophy) or equivalent doctoral degree in a relevant field, awarded within the last 5 years.
Research focus or expertise needed: Alignment with host lab's projects, such as environmental science or public health in Sri Lankan contexts.
Preferred experience: At least 3-5 peer-reviewed publications, prior grant involvement, or conference presentations. Experience with Sri Lankan research ethics boards is advantageous.

Postdoc: Informal shorthand for postdoctoral researcher or fellow, denoting a phase of advanced training post-PhD.
Principal Investigator (PI): The lead scientist responsible for a research project, overseeing postdocs and funding.
Peer-reviewed publications: Scholarly articles vetted by experts for validity and originality before journal acceptance.
